When evaluating storage facilities near you, consider these local tips. First, assess accessibility: given our variable weather, look for facilities with covered loading areas or drive-up access for easier moving during rain or snow. Second, prioritize security—our tight-knit community values safety, so seek out facilities with 24/7 surveillance, gated access, and well-lit premises. Third, consider climate control, especially if storing heirlooms, documents, or electronics, as our humid summers and cold winters can damage sensitive items.
For Lansdowne residents, convenience is key. Look for facilities offering flexible hours or 24-hour access to accommodate busy schedules. Many local facilities provide truck rentals or moving supplies, saving you trips to distant big-box stores. Don't forget to inquire about community-specific discounts; some facilities offer promotions for local residents, students, or military personnel.
Before choosing, visit potential facilities in person if possible. Check cleanliness, observe staff helpfulness, and test gate systems. Read local reviews to gauge experiences from your neighbors. Remember, the cheapest option isn't always the best value—reliable access and peace of mind are worth the investment.
